Silver City And Deming Receive Resilient Communities Fund Grants to Aid Economic Recovery Efforts

By News Editor And Partners • 3 hours ago   Santa Fe, N.M. – The New Mexico Resiliency Alliance, in partnership with New Mexico MainStreet (NMMS) and the McCune Charitable Foundation, awarded ten  Resilient Communities Fund Grants to NMMS affiliated districts for community and economic development projects. Awarded projects have a clear and stated impact for new, innovative, or ongoing efforts to mediate the impacts of the Covid-19 pandemic and/or economic recovery efforts. Projects will be completed by December 2021.  Here is a statement from  New Mexico MainStreet: The  Resilient Communities Fund provides financial support for locally-driven, community-based, economic development projects in New Mexico’s rural and underserved communities. The Resiliency Alliance has awarded more than $350,000 in small grants since 2014.
